Torque2D Reference
 All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Groups Pages
Stream Member List

This is the complete list of members for Stream, including all inherited members.

_read(const U32 in_numBytes, void *out_pBuffer)=0Streamprotectedpure virtual
_write(const U32 in_numBytes, const void *in_pBuffer)=0Streamprotectedpure virtual
Capability enum nameStream
Closed enum valueStream
copyFrom(Stream *other)Stream
EOS enum valueStream
getPosition() const =0Streampure virtual
getStatus() const Streaminline
getStatusString(const Status in_status)Streamstatic
getStreamSize()=0Streampure virtual
hasCapability(const Capability) const =0Streampure virtual
IllegalCall enum valueStream
IOError enum valueStream
Ok enum valueStream
Put(char character)Streaminline
read(ColorI *)Stream
read(ColorF *)Stream
read(const U32 in_numBytes, void *out_pBuffer)Streaminline
read(bool *out_pRead)Streaminline
readLine(U8 *buffer, U32 bufferSize)Stream
readLongString(U32 maxStringLen, char *stringBuf)Stream
readString(char stringBuf[256])Streamvirtual
readSTString(bool casesens=false)Stream
setPosition(const U32 in_newPosition)=0Streampure virtual
setStatus(const Status in_newStatus)Streaminlineprotected
Status enum nameStream
Stream()Stream
StreamPosition enum valueStream
StreamRead enum valueStream
StreamWrite enum valueStream
UnknownError enum valueStream
write(const ColorI &)Stream
write(const ColorF &)Stream
write(const U32 in_numBytes, const void *in_pBuffer)Streaminline
write(const bool &in_rWrite)Streaminline
writeFormattedBuffer(const char *format,...)Stream
writeLine(U8 *buffer)Stream
writeLongString(U32 maxStringLen, const char *string)Stream
writeString(const char *stringBuf, S32 maxLen=255)Streamvirtual
writeStringBuffer(const char *buffer)Streaminline
writeTabs(U32 count)Streaminline
~Stream()Streamvirtual